Output d0e9138e431523fb3adcd82cc30ecab40ef4fa6d6c6a2e922d8d518f16ace4e4:0

value
13017666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de53602c0cb527f423e2b33ab67a3b35f498d992 OP_EQUAL
address
2NDWmsuwV8tYsbYsEp5NgYNGUkxT4ukJD3D
transaction
d0e9138e431523fb3adcd82cc30ecab40ef4fa6d6c6a2e922d8d518f16ace4e4